The Caswell Sisters are set to perform Friday, July 18 at 7 p.m. at the Bartholomew County Public LibraryThis year, WFIU Public Radio is coming back with the much-awaited Jazz in July, a free outdoor summer concert featuring celebrated jazz artists, at Columbus. The Caswell Sisters will perform at Jazz in July on Friday, July 18 at 7 p.m. at the Bartholomew County Public Library. Should it rain, the concert will be moved indoors to the Columbus Commons. The performance will be emceed by David Brent Johnson, host of two of WFIU’s long-running jazz programs, Night Lights and Just You & Me. Guests are free to bring lawn chairs or blankets to the concert. Food trucks will also be available at the event. Vocalist Rachel and violinist Sara Caswell’s debut album, Alive in the Singing Air (Turtle Ridge Records) featuring Fred Hersch, was released in 2013 and was selected by jazz critic Thomas Cunniffe as one of the year’s “Best Vocal CDs” on JazzHistory Online.
The talented sibling duo attended Indiana University Bloomington, and are now esteemed faculty members at the Berklee College of Music, Manhattan School of Music, The New School, New York University, and IU’s Jacobs School of Music. Their careers have witnessed several accolades, including a Grammy nomination for Sara. The Caswell Sisters have recorded with distinguished artists such as the WDR Big Band, Esperanza Spalding, and Chris Potter.
